Quick answer
Direct answer: Clear window decals are a specialized form of window graphic for designs that should appear to float on compatible glass. The customer or installer supplies verified pane dimensions, viewing direction, glass and coating details, and the application plan; the proof identifies clear areas, printed color, and any available white layer included in the quote.
Key takeaways
- Transparent printed colors can look muted or shift against reflections, tint, and whatever is behind the glass; white ink changes that result.
- Supply verified visible-glass dimensions, note frames and hardware, and say whether the graphic is read from outside, inside, or both.
- Film removal depends on the adhesive, age, exposure, glass coating, and maintenance history; test sensitive or treated glass first.

FAQ
Where can I use clear window decals?
They are intended for compatible smooth glass on storefronts, doors, interior partitions, and display windows. Textured, coated, damaged, dirty, or low-energy surfaces may need testing or a different film.
How long do clear window decals last?
Service life varies with film selection, sun and weather exposure, glass orientation, cleaning products, edge contact, and application quality. Share whether the decal faces indoors or outdoors and whether the glass has strong daily sun so the material can be reviewed without promising a fixed lifespan.
Do they leave residue when removed?
Removal results vary with adhesive type, age, heat, UV exposure, glass coating, and maintenance. Ask for a removable-film option when changeability matters, and have the customer or installer test any treated or sensitive glass before a full application.
Can I apply them inside or outside the glass?
Both orientations may be possible. An inside-glass graphic needs reverse printing or the appropriate adhesive construction to read correctly from outdoors, while tint, reflections, and coated glass can change visibility or compatibility.
What if I need vibrant colors on clear material?
A white underlayer may make color more opaque when that construction is available and included in the quote. Without white, printed colors remain translucent and can shift against the background. The proof defines any approved white placement, but viewing conditions still affect appearance.
